For those not in the know, it's a treasure hunt. All over the world there are these little hidden packages called caches, which can be found using GPS and a few clues left by the person who deposited the cache. Items inside the cache can be taken home, as long as you leave something of equil or greater value in its place. The clues and GPS coordinates can both be found on the Geocaching website and you can log when you too have found a cache. Have a look at their website for more info. http://www.geocaching.com/
